The Jiangsu Water Quality Monitoring Technical Regulations is a set of rules that governs the water quality monitoring in the province of Jiangsu. The regulations are aimed at ensuring that water quality in the province is monitored regularly and that any deviations from standard are detected and addressed promptly. The regulations cover various aspects of water quality monitoring, including the types of instruments and methods used, sampling procedures, data collection, analysis, and reporting。

Technical Regulations for Water Quality Monitoring in Jiangsu Province

This document is intended to provide a comprehensive guide for water quality monitoring in Jiangsu Province, China. It outlines the specific procedures and protocols that should be followed by water monitoring agencies to ensure accuracy and reliability in their data collection, analysis, and reporting.

The first section of the document deals with the basic principles of water quality monitoring. It defines key water quality parameters, such as pH, dissolved oxygen, total dissolved solids, and nutrient levels, and explains how these parameters are measured and analyzed. The document also discusses the importance of environmental factors, such as temperature, pressure, and salinity, in shaping water quality.

The next section describes the specific equipment and technologies used for water quality monitoring in Jiangsu Province. This includes details on the types of sensors and meters used, as well as the software and data management systems that support these activities. The document emphasizes the importance of maintaining accurate and up-to-date equipment, as well as the need for regular calibration and maintenance procedures.

A crucial component of water quality monitoring in Jiangsu Province is data collection and analysis. The third section of the document provides detailed instructions for conducting water quality monitoring tests at different locations throughout the province. This includes guidelines for sample collection, transportation, and handling, as well as best practices for analyzing water samples and interpreting the results. The document also stresses the importance of adhering to strict quality control protocols to ensure the accuracy and reliability of all data collected.

Once data has been collected and analyzed, the fourth section of the document outlines the steps involved in preparing reports and presenting findings to stakeholders. This includes details on how to structure reports, identify key trends and patterns in data, and communicate findings effectively to decision-makers at all levels of government and industry. The document also emphasizes the importance of transparent reporting and providing access to relevant data to promote public understanding and participation in water quality management initiatives.

Finally, the document concludes with a section dedicated to ongoing monitoring and improvement. This includes recommendations for periodic review and update of monitoring protocols and procedures, as well as suggestions for incorporating new technologies or methodologies into water quality monitoring efforts. The goal of this section is to encourage a culture of continuous improvement in water quality management practices in Jiangsu Province.

In conclusion, "Technical Regulations for Water Quality Monitoring in Jiangsu Province" is a comprehensive guide designed to standardize and improve water quality monitoring practices in one of China's most important provinces. By following the procedures outlined in this document, water monitoring agencies can ensure that they collect accurate, reliable, and comprehensive data that can be used to support a wide range of water management initiatives.
